Recommended Replacement: While there’s no set mileage for a timing chain replacement, mechanics, they can become problematic with mileage as low as 60k! If you’ve been symptom free, then we’d recommend replacing the timing chain between 70,000 miles and/or 9 years. This timeframe is a guide only and can vary depending on driving conditions and usage.

A broken timing chain will likely cause significant internal engine damage, leading to costly repairs.  Early detection and replacement are key to avoiding this scenario and will be your cheapest option. If the chain snaps, you’ll either lose sudden engine function if the car is in motion, or you just wont be able to start it, if the vehicle is static when it breaks.

The timing chain plays a vital role of the engine, responsible for synchronising the movements of the crankshaft and camshaft. This ensures your engine valves open and close at the precise moments needed for optimal performance and fuel efficiency.

Regular maintenance: Following your BMW’s recommended service schedule, including oil changes with the correct oil type, helps maintain optimal timing chain performance.

BMW and MINI use Timing Chains in almost every model of engine that they produce.  It is recommended to replace your timing chain before failure (usually upwards of 60k) as repair prices can become very high from internal engine damage.

If you experience any of these symptoms, or if your BMW is approaching the recommended replacement mileage or age, schedule an appointment with a trusted mechanic. They can inspect your timing chain and advise on the best course of action.

Listen to your car: Be mindful of subtle changes in your vehicle’s behaviour. Early detection of potential timing chain issues can save you money and keep your BMW running smoothly for miles to come.

Unusual noises: A noisy rattling sound, particularly when idling from a cold engine start, might suggest a loose timing chain scraping against other components.

Unlike timing belts, which typically require replacement every 60,000 miles, BMWs and MINIs use timing chains designed to last longer.  However, these chains are not maintenance-free and can fail.
